In and Out

Capturing a moving subject or “Panning” as we say amongst photographers, has often been a great challenge to me; the wrong settings and the moment is gone. I love to watch them surf. The resilience of the river surfers is incredible, in and out continuously, for hours and hours.

Originally from Milan, but currently based in Munich. The style of photography I shoot ranges from portraits, travel, wildlife, but mostly street photography. For the past 10 years I have been shooting daily to collect moments, because I want to remind myself to not forget the person I was, the people I’ve met, the places I’ve been, the smell, the sun on my skin, my feelings, a kiss and a hug, who loved me and who I loved. Photography is my personal time machine.

I am a storyteller and I believe in people, love and communication. These three ingredients often fit together perfectly to create something very unique; be part of my stories.
